Summary: The gruesome double murder at an Eastvale property developer's luxury home should be an open and shut case for Superintendent Banks. There's a clear link to the notoriously vicious Albanian mafia. Then they find a cache of spy-cam videos hidden in the house and Annie and Gerry's investigation pivots to the rape of a young girl that could cast the murders in an entirely different light. Banks's friend Zelda, increasingly uncertain of her future in Britain's hostile environment, thinks she will be safer in Moldova hunting the men who abducted, raped and enslaved her. Her search takes her back to the orphanage where it all began. But Zelda is putting herself in greater danger than any she's seen before.
